// Type definitions for cy-spok wrapper // The runtime export is a function (expectations) => (value) => void // augmented with all the properties of underlying spok plus reference to the original spok. import type spokOriginal from '@bahmutov/spok' // Re-export selected upstream types for convenience export type { Specifications } from '@bahmutov/spok/dist/spok' // Pull in upstream default export type type SpokRuntime = typeof spokOriginal // Our assertion result collector (mirrors runtime implementation, but minimal surface) export interface CySpokAssert { failed: string[] passed: string[] equal(actual: any, expected: any, msg?: string): void deepEqual(actual: any, expected: any, msg?: string): void } // Function returned by calling cy-spok with specifications; Cypress will call it with the subject value export type CySpokFunction<Subject = any> = (value: Subject) => void // Helper function signature: accepts specifications and returns a function to be used in cy.should() export interface CySpokHelper { <Subject = any>( specifications: import('@bahmutov/spok/dist/spok').Specifications, ): CySpokFunction<Subject> } // The exported value combines callable helper + all spok predicates + a reference to original spok export interface CySpok extends CySpokHelper, SpokRuntime { spok: SpokRuntime } declare const cySpok: CySpok export default cySpok
